At this hands-on science museum, kids can look at insects under microscopes, solve crimes using chemical forensics, and explore the physics of baseball. Out front they'll climb on Pheena, a life-size blue-whale model, and clamber over a giant strand of DNA. Out back, it's all about how earthquakes and water have shaped the bay, and from all vantage points sweeping views of the bay and beyond...
